Learning outcomes
The student is able to
- plan, implement and evaluate nursing of patients at different life stages
- assess the need for services and care of vulnerable and multicultural patients
- apply client-centred working methods to improve the inclusion, well-being and rehabilitation of clients
- work in a multidisciplinary team and network taking advantage of shared expertise

Co-operation with working life and/or RDI
Part 1.
- LbD topic: Mental wellbeing of immigrants
- LbD-environment:
- Students will plan and implement program for immigrants to support mental wellbeing
- Return of project plan one week before group's implementation day
